On Sunday, December 22, 2024, at approximately 3:30 p.m., police were dispatched to Higgins Bay in Regina for the report of a firearm discharge.
Police arrived and observed two male youths fleeing the area on foot. The youths, aged 17 and 14, were arrested at a residence on Oakview Drive. Upon search, firearm ammunition was recovered on the 17 year-old, and bear spray on the 14 year-old. Further search of the arrested area by Regina Police Service Canine Unit revealed a firearm with ammunition.
It is not believed that anyone was hurt during the firearm discharge. During investigation, a 17 year-old female was found to be intoxicated, and in breach of court-ordered conditions not to possess or consume alcohol or drugs. She was also arrested and charged.
A 17 year-old male, who cannot be named in keeping with the provisions of the Youth Criminal Justice Act, is charged with:
- Fail to comply [YCJA 137];
- 2 X Possession of Firearm/Ammunition Contrary to Prohibition Order [CC 117.01(1)];
- Possession of a Prohibited/Restricted Firearm [CC 95(1)(A)]; and
- Possession of a Firearm Knowing Its Possession Unauthorized [CC 92(1)].
A 14 year-old male, who cannot be named in keeping with the provisions of the Youth Criminal Justice Act, is charged with:
- Possession of a Weapon [CC 88];
- Carry Concealed Weapon [CC 90];
- Possession of a Prohibited/Restricted Firearm [CC 95(1)(A)]; and
- Possession of a Firearm Knowing Its Possession Unauthorized [CC 92(1)].
A 17 year-old female, who cannot be named in keeping with the provisions of the Youth Criminal Justice Act, is charged with:
- Fail to comply [YCJA 137].
The accused made their first appearances on these charges in Provincial Youth Court yesterday, December 23, 2024, at 2:00 p.m.
